Overview

Tumor membrane vesicle vaccines (TMV vaccines) are a form of cancer immunotherapy that utilize vesicles derived from the membranes of tumor cells. These vaccines are typically prepared by isolating the plasma membranes from a patient's own (autologous) or allogeneic tumor cells and forming them into nanoscale vesicles. The resulting TMVs display a broad array of native tumor antigens on their surface, which can stimulate an immune response when administered as a vaccine. In some approaches, these TMVs are further engineered to incorporate immunostimulatory molecules such as GPI-anchored B7-1 and IL-12 to enhance their immunogenicity[6][4]. The mechanism of action involves presenting multiple patient-specific or shared tumor antigens to the immune system in their natural conformation, thereby inducing both innate and adaptive anti-tumor immunity. Preclinical studies have shown that TMV vaccines can inhibit tumor growth, improve survival in animal models of head and neck squamous cell carcinoma (HNSCC), induce long-term anti-tumor memory responses, and synergize with immune checkpoint inhibitors like anti-PD1 antibodies in certain models[6][7]. This approach is considered highly personalized when using autologous material.
